IP查询
查询
你查询的IP:[121.58.98.183] 地理位置:中国–海南
最新查询
117.72.0.22
119.144.222.6
117.112.4.211
122.192.178.178
210.5.31.123
58.14.144.68
202.92.20.104
119.2.15.61
120.90.6.10
121.58.98.183
117.100.93.197
202.95.252.143
123.144.128.175
116.213.64.52
116.89.144.168
114.80.64.238
60.245.128.162
122.44.128.23
202.46.32.89
125.210.66.240
161.207.53.34
118.244.130.183
124.243.192.122
60.200.145.125
122.102.64.56
117.60.40.35
116.116.50.0
202.8.128.213
218.64.137.115
221.146.183.211
61.87.192.166